Understanding Mold Growth After Flooding
Floodwater creates an ideal environment for mold growth, especially in crawlspaces. Understanding how and why mold thrives in these conditions is essential for effective remediation.
Why Floodwater Promotes Mold in Crawlspaces
Floodwater introduces not just moisture but also a range of contaminants. In crawlspaces, stagnant water mixes with organic materials like wood and insulation, which provide nutrients for mold.
The dark, enclosed nature of crawlspaces offers minimal airflow, increasing humidity levels. Mold spores, which are ubiquitous, can thrive in these damp conditions, leading to rapid proliferation if not addressed promptly.
Keeping crawlspaces ventilated and using moisture barriers can greatly reduce the chances of mold establishment. Addressing water intrusion quickly is crucial for preventing a persistently humid environment.
How Fast Mold Grows After a Flood
Mold can begin to develop within 24 to 48 hours after flood exposure. If the conditions are right—adequate warmth, moisture, and lack of airflow—mold spores can germinate almost immediately.
In crawlspaces, where conditions often remain damp, the risk is particularly high. Mold can compromise not only the integrity of the building materials but also the health of the occupants by releasing mycotoxins into the air.
Acting swiftly to dry out affected areas and remove wet materials is essential. This includes removing any soaked insulation or wood that cannot be adequately dried.

Assessing Water Damage and Mold Presence
Understanding the extent of water damage is crucial for effective remediation, especially in crawlspaces prone to mold growth. This section outlines steps for initial inspection, identifying signs of mold, and exploring professional assessment options.
Initial Inspection Steps
Begin by conducting a thorough visual inspection of the crawlspace. Look for areas where water has pooled or where mud residue is present. Document any visible water damage, such as discoloration on walls or ceilings.
Key areas to check include:
- Insulation: Look for sagging or damp insulation materials.
- Wood Structures: Check for warping or softness in beams and panels.
- Ductwork: Ensure there are no signs of water intrusion.
After the visual inspection, use a moisture meter to identify hidden moisture levels in walls and floors. A reading above 20% indicates potential mold growth risks.

Essential Safety Precautions Before Cleanup
Before beginning mold cleanup in crawlspaces following a flood, it is crucial to prioritize safety. The environment can pose various health risks and physical hazards. Proper precautions help ensure that the cleanup process is conducted safely and effectively.
Personal Protective Equipment Overview
Before entering a flooded crawlspace, individuals must equip themselves with appropriate personal protective equipment (PPE). This should include:
- Gloves: Nitrile or rubber gloves protect hands from direct contact with mold and contaminated materials.
- Masks: Respirators with N95 filtration are essential to prevent inhalation of mold spores and contaminants.
- Coveralls: Disposable or washable coveralls minimize skin exposure to allergens and bacteria.
- Boots: Waterproof boots provide protection from waterlogged areas and potential electrical hazards.
Proper use of PPE is essential in reducing exposure to harmful substances present in the environment.

Immediate Actions for Effective Flood Cleanup
Effective flood cleanup involves prompt actions to minimize damage and prevent mold growth. Proper water removal, disposal of contaminated materials, and adequate drying and ventilation are critical steps in protecting properties, especially in crawlspaces.
Removing Standing Water Efficiently
The first priority in flood cleanup is to remove standing water as quickly as possible. Professionals recommend using submersible pumps or wet vacuums tailored for large volumes of water.
- Safety First: Before starting, ensure that electricity is turned off in the affected areas to prevent electrical hazards.
- Equipment: Utilize industrial-grade pumps for swift water extraction. This minimizes water exposure time and reduces mold risk.
Once the larger volume is addressed, attention should shift to smaller pockets of water. Mops and towels can assist in this process.
Implementing these methods effectively can lead to a faster recovery time for the crawlspace.
Disposing of Contaminated Materials
After water removal, assessing the condition of materials is essential. Any items that have absorbed floodwater, such as carpets, drywall, or insulation, may harbor contaminants and should be discarded.
- Identify Contaminants: Floodwater can carry harmful substances like sewage and chemicals, making careful evaluation crucial.
- Proper Disposal: Contaminated items must be placed in sealed bags to prevent spreading pollutants during disposal.
Local regulations should be observed for disposal. Unwanted items must not only be removed but also documented for potential insurance claims.
Drying and Ventilating Crawlspaces
Once the water has been removed and contaminated materials disposed of, the next step is to dry and ventilate the crawlspace thoroughly.
- Airflow Techniques: Open vents and windows to facilitate air circulation. Use fans and dehumidifiers to speed up the drying process.
- Monitor Humidity Levels: Keeping humidity below 60% is key in preventing mold return.
Ensuring that the crawlspace remains dry will help maintain a safe environment, further protecting the integrity of the home. Proper ventilation plays a crucial role in creating a healthy space post-flood.

Preventing Future Mold Growth in Crawlspaces
To prevent future mold growth in crawlspaces, it is essential to address moisture control, repair any structural issues, and maintain the space effectively. Implementing these strategies will significantly reduce the risk of mold infestations following water damage.
Improving Drainage and Moisture Control
Effective drainage systems are critical in mitigating the risks associated with mold growth. Homeowners should ensure that gutters and downspouts direct water at least five feet away from the foundation. Regularly inspect and clean gutters to prevent blockages that can lead to overflowing.
Installing a sump pump in high-risk areas can also manage excess groundwater. Additionally, the use of a dehumidifier can maintain humidity levels below 60%, preventing the stagnant moisture that encourages mold growth.
Monitoring moisture levels regularly with a hygrometer can help identify potential problems before they escalate.
Sealing and Repairing Foundation Issues
Identifying and repairing cracks in the foundation is vital to preventing mold. Water can seep into crawlspaces through these cracks, contributing to moisture buildup. Homeowners should fill any gaps with appropriate sealants and consult professionals for larger structural issues.
Check for leaks around plumbing systems and HVAC ducts, sealing any leaks to prevent water intrusion. Insulating exposed pipes can also reduce condensation, further minimizing moisture.
It is essential to assess crawlspace ventilation; installing vents can keep air flowing and reduce humidity, creating an environment less conducive to mold.

Understanding Insurance Coverage for Flood and Mold
Understanding the nuances of insurance coverage is crucial post-flood. Standard homeowners' insurance typically does not cover flood damage. Instead, a separate flood insurance policy is necessary, often provided under the National Flood Insurance Program (NFIP).
Additionally, mold damage may not be included in flood insurance policies unless the property owner took timely actions to mitigate it. This includes drying out materials and removing water-damaged items promptly. Policyholders should review their specific coverage details and consult their insurance agent for clarity on claims related to mold remediation.

When should a professional service be contacted for post-flood mold issues in a crawlspace?
A professional should be called if mold growth exceeds a certain area, typically 10 square feet. If the mold is caused by contaminated water or if there are concerns about structural damage, expert assistance is warranted. Professionals have specialized equipment to effectively address extensive mold issues.
